			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Danny Gokey, one of the American Idol finalists from the most-recent season, has signed a contract with 19 Recordings/RCA Nashville, furthering his dream of becoming a country artist. Danny, who finished within the top-three, is expected to release his debut album sometime next year. Born and raised in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, Danny is currently touring with other finalists on the &#8220;American Idols Live! Tour 2009.&#8221; Carrie Underwood and Kellie Pickler both have joint contracts with 19 Recordings and Sony Music imprints, which feature RCA Nashville, BNA, and Arista Nashville.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>It has been an interesting ride this season of American Idol, and I&#8217;ve been considering how biased the judges seem this season. It is obvious they love Adam Lambert and even Simon Cowell has proclaimed that Adam will be the winner this season. In season&#8217;s past, the judges have seemed to have their favorites, but not to the detriment of other contestants.</p>
<p>A few observations.</p>
<p>1) Simon chose an amazing song from U2 for Adam to sing (whereas the song chosen by Paula for Danny was almost completely unknown and did not showcase his voice, and the song for Kris was just a copy of the original).</p>
<p>2) Adam Lambert has gone last (prime performing spot) more than any of the other contestants remaining &#8212; and he went last again tonight.</p>
<p>3) Adam has been given extra spotlights on entrances and staging (example: the red lit staircase from last week).</p>
<p>4) This is the first time in American Idol history (at least that I can recall) that Simon has actually urged viewers to vote for a specific contestant &#8211; Adam Lambert.</p>
<p>5) Simon helped get Adam a specific arrangement for the U2 song tonight, and accused Randy and Kara of not giving Kris an arrangement that would spotlight his voice. Both Randy and Kara proclaimed they didn&#8217;t know they were allowed to do that&#8230;.</p>
<p>6) Tonight specifically the judges were very distracting after performances by both Kris and Danny&#8230; arguing, teasing, Simon covering Paula&#8217;s mouth so she couldn&#8217;t speak&#8230; and yet no distractions just rave reviews after Adam&#8217;s performances.</p>
<p>Hmmm&#8230; not biased at all.  What do you think?</p>
<p>It will be interesting to see if America follows the preferences of the judges, or select one of the other contestants as the winner. At this point, I don&#8217;t think it really matters who wins. They will all have careers in the music industry. Obviously the winner will be &#8220;owned&#8221; by American Idol for the first year of their contract and will have tremendous obligations to go on the circuit and be involved in loads of travel. The runner up will have to go on the American Idol tour, but may end up having more opportunities to record their album and even get it released before the winner does.</p>
